Duplicating Boards

You can use the old board to create a new, similar one without having to recreate all the cards and settings from scratch. Learn how to copy a board.

You must have an Adding Board role to duplicate boards.

In order to duplicate a board:

  1. Go to Board Menu.
  2. Select  Copy Board.

Another way to make this action is selecting this option from the board tile in KanBo Home Page.

  1. Then, you need to enter the name for the new board. Optionally you can set a start and end date or change the default background color.
  2. If there were document sources, you must decide, if you want to:
    • copy,
    • attach,
    • or don’t include documents at all.
  3. Then you must select to create New Office 365 Group or attach to existing one.
  1. Press Copy.

Another way to create a new board based on the existing board is the board template. Use your proven board as a pattern for new ones.
